Output 100089afe00ae7804b6d0ad70fd9a3852d2f5aa7c9d31bcee91bbdc0d5e0a668:1

value
402558008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612515b9ce198108544fcad5f965c4d27b6c922a OP_EQUAL
address
3AYftrRjHKSpZyaqPrUi1Z8QDxxz6mbBjd
transaction
100089afe00ae7804b6d0ad70fd9a3852d2f5aa7c9d31bcee91bbdc0d5e0a668
spent
true